 I am trying to open the server for TCP/IP connection. My server is RedHat 7.2(postgresql-7.1.3).My question is - Is it necessary to edit  etc/rc.d/init.d/postgresql  and appened -i and -o options in postgres start script line.
 
I am trying to acheive this by changing the tcp-connaction flag in postgresql.conf file in data directory. But it does not seem to be working on this platform. But I used to do the same on Solaris and it perfectly worked.
